compounding of growth
A growth rate of 1 or 2 percent a year sounds tiny, almost not worth arguing about. But growth compounds: each year's gain builds on a slightly bigger base than the year before, so the effect snowballs. Over a human lifetime or a country's history, those small annual percentages stack into staggering differences. Understanding compounding is the difference between dismissing growth rates as trivial and seeing why economists fight so hard over a fraction of a percentage point.
Compounding means growth applies to an ever-larger total, the same mathematics that makes savings grow with compound interest. There is a handy shortcut called the rule of 70: divide 70 by the annual growth rate to get the rough number of years for something to double. At 2 percent a year, an economy doubles in about 70 divided by 2, which is 35 years; at 7 percent it doubles in only 10 years; at 1 percent it takes about 70 years, two human generations. The arithmetic is unforgiving in both directions: a country growing at 4 percent will, over a century, become vastly richer than one growing at 2 percent, not twice as rich but many times richer, because the gap itself keeps compounding.
Compounding matters because it explains why long-run growth rates are arguably the most important numbers in economics. As Robert Lucas wrote, once you start thinking about the consequences of growth differences for human welfare, it is hard to think about anything else. It is why a policy that nudges the growth rate up by even half a percentage point, sustained for decades, can matter more for living standards than almost any one-off program. And it is a double-edged lesson: the same relentless compounding that builds prosperity also drives concerns about whether resource use and environmental pressure can grow exponentially forever.
Using the rule of 70: an economy growing 2 percent a year doubles in about 35 years, while one growing 4 percent doubles in about 17.5 years. After 70 years, the 2 percent economy is 4 times bigger, but the 4 percent economy is about 16 times bigger.

The rule of 70 is an approximation, accurate for small growth rates but less so for large ones. Its deeper point holds firmly: tiny, sustained differences in growth rates produce enormous differences in the long run.
